## Session Handling for Health Checks

The Corvel gateway sits behind the Lanternside load balancer, which probes /healthz every ten seconds. Health-check requests are stateless by design: they bypass the session store entirely so that probe traffic never inflates session counts or evicts real user sessions. New team members should note that the deep-check endpoint, /healthz/deep, does verify session-store connectivity and therefore requires authentication. When probing it manually, supply the token below.

bearer token for tajep-kajef: eyJhbGciOiJIUzI1NiIsInR5cCI6IkpXVCJ9.eyJzdWIiOiIoOsZ23In0.CsygO0hs

## Idempotency Keys for Payment Retries (Lumopay)

Every retry of a charge request must reuse the original idempotency key; generating a new key on retry can produce duplicate charges. Keys are scoped per merchant and expire after 48 hours. Reviewers should verify keys are derived server-side, never from client input. The full key-generation specification and threat model are maintained on the internal page.

dashboard of kaguf-tawip = https://vault.merlaqsys.test/issue

Subject: Contrast audit results are in!

Hey all (especially the new folks) — the color-contrast accessibility audit for the Dovetail dashboard wrapped up today. Good news: most components pass. Bad news: the warning badges and the muted sidebar links fail at small sizes, so those fixes are going into this release. Check the audit doc before touching any theme tokens. The audit ran against the following build.

build token for kagaf-hahof: htk14_9d3d4d26d7d8de